🐛 Fix leaked focus timers in dashboard sidebar navigation (#10715)
* 🐛 Fix leaked deferred DOM ops on dashboard navigation and template clone

The React reconciliation "removeChild" error surfaced during rapid
dashboard navigation because several effects scheduled deferred DOM
operations (focus, CSS positioning) without returning a cleanup that
cancelled them. When the component unmounted before the callback
fired, it ran against stale DOM and desynchronized React fiber tree
from the actual DOM.

- context_menu_a11y.cljs: replace tm/schedule-on-idle (30s idle
  window) with tm/schedule (setTimeout 0) and return a rx/dispose!
  cleanup.
- dropdown.cljs: capture the tm/schedule handle and dispose it in
  the effect cleanup.
- tooltip.cljs: capture the ts/raf handle and cancel it on cleanup.

* 🐛 Fix leaked focus timers in dashboard sidebar navigation

Six sidebar navigation handlers scheduled setTimeout callbacks to mutate
tabindex/focus on React-managed title elements without cancelling prior
pending callbacks. During rapid keyboard navigation (Projects→Fonts→Libs→Drafts)
the stale callbacks fired against unmounted DOM, desyncing React fiber tree
and triggering "removeChild" NotFoundError.

- sidebar-project*: cancel prior timer in on-key-down
- sidebar-search*: cancel prior timer in on-key-press
- sidebar-content*: cancel prior timer in go-projects-with-key,
  go-fonts-with-key, go-drafts-with-key, go-libs-with-key

Each handler now stores the timer handle in a component-level ref and
disposes any pending handle before scheduling a new one.
